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
For this purpose a single-centre non-blinded trial was designed where two groups of patients were observed, a cold (cryotherapy) C-group and a regular (control) R-group. Depended on the week they were operated patients received either usual care (R-group) or computed-assesed- cryotherapy (odd or even week; week-on/week-off principle). Patients in the C-group received next to usual postoperative care computer-assisted cryotherapy for several hours a day during the first seven postoperative days (10-12 degrees Celcius).
Primary outcome was pain, monitored with the numerical rating scale for pain. Secondary outcomes were the use of opioid escape medication, function and swelling, monitored by active range of motion, timed up and go test and circumference measurements; several patient-reported outcome measures (short term 2 and 6 weeks; and longer term 6 and 12 months postoperative); and patient satisfaction, monitored by the numerical rating scale for satisfaction.

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
For the CAC in the C-group, the ZAMAR ZHC-MG665A (ZAMAR, Vrsar, Croatia) was used during hospitalisation and the smaller CAC system ZAMAR ZT Cube (ZAMAR, Vrsar, Croatia) for the home situation. The CAC system was delivered to the patient's home before the day of the surgery. Both models had a touchscreen with pre-set programs, with parameters as shown in the cooling schedule. All patients received a personal cooling brace, the ZAMAR Wrap, which transferred cold onto the skin and deep tissue around the knee. Patients in the C-group were instructed to cool the operated knee during the first seven postoperative days. The schedule they received was based on a schedule used by Thijs et al. Patients were allowed to deviate from this schedule, but were asked to document the actual cooling time and temperature in a log.
